Output bd112e7bbe4edd15c3d51c6423fccb5bec704785245f4cc5bef33d790ca41552:67

value
5107754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3749f7efee547cdac0b8db64227b659d3f55a OP_EQUAL
address
3BMEXGtQP4psFkJaEzbr1Y2VUiLr3oKnVD
transaction
bd112e7bbe4edd15c3d51c6423fccb5bec704785245f4cc5bef33d790ca41552
confirmations
377656
spent
true